You might be asking the wrong questions.
Not bad ones.
Just ones that never get past small talk.
And if that's happening in your voir dire… you're missing the moment where jurors actually connect.
Because connection doesn't come from:
"Where are you from?"
"What do you do?"
"Have you ever…?"
It comes from something deeper.
From getting jurors to talk about what they value and actually staying there long enough for it to mean something.
Most attorneys don't do this.
Not because they don't care… but because they've never been shown how.
And that gap? It shows up later in your damages.

Quote:
"What we're really wanting from our jurors is to invest in the process. And the best time to do that is in voir dire — when they can talk about themselves and what they value… because at its core, what our plaintiff attorneys are fighting for are human values, things that we all care about. And that's what was taken in every single case."
Sari de la Motte
